Aberdeen City Planning Commission September 17, 2019 MINUTES ABERDEEN CITY PLANNING COMMISSION September 17, 2019 The City Planning Commission was called to order by Chairman Dean Marske. Members present at roll call were Mettler, Woodward, Cogley, Lien, Schumacher, and Marske. Absent was Mitchell. Also present were Brett Bill, Planning & Zoning Director, Eric Miller, City Planner, and Ken Hubbart, City Planner. Schumacher moved and Lien seconded to approve the Aberdeen City minutes of August 20, 2019, all members voting aye, the motion carried. OPEN FORUM – No one was present. There being no old business Chairman Marske began with new business as follows: 1) A petition to rezone from (I-2) Unrestricted Industrial District to (C-2) Highway Commercial District for property described as “Lot 1, Steele-Teigen Addition to Aberdeen, in the NW ¼ of Section 16, T123N-R64W of the 5th P.M., Brown County, South Dakota,” (a.k.a. 4015 Steele Ave SE) was submitted by Erickson Teigen Property, LLC. Mark Erickson and Kris Teigen were present to represent the property. Eric Miller stated that the petitioner is requesting this petition to rezone in order to bring the property into a zoning district that has less restrictive sign setback requirements. The new sign on this property was installed closer to the property line than the required 20’ setback in the Unrestricted Industrial District. Rezoning this property to the (C-2) Highway Commercial District would bring the petitioners sign in to conformance with the 10’ setback requirements in that zoning district. Following discussion Lien moved and Woodward seconded to approve with the stipulation that the petitioners have sidewalks installed along Steele Avenue SE in accordance with Section 46-127 of the Aberdeen City Code. Upon roll call, all members voting aye, the motion carried. 2) A preliminary and final plat described as “Grismer First Addition to the City of Aberdeen, in the NE ¼ of Section 13, T123N-R64W of the 5th P.M., Brown County, South Dakota,” (a.k.a. 310 Kline St N) was submitted by James Grismer. Eric Miller stated that the petitioner is requesting this preliminary and final plat in order to combine multiple underlying lots into one legal parcel to allow for construction of a detached garage. Following discussion Cogley moved and Schumacher seconded to approve, all members voting aye, the motion carried. 3) A petition to vacate public right-of-way described as “Arch Street S Public ROW between 15th Ave SE and 17th Ave SE, adjacent to Lots 1-7, Block 2, Lots 1-4, Block 3, Lots 8-14, Block 1 and Lots 9-12, Block 4, Melgaard Addition to Aberdeen, 16th Ave SE Public ROW between State Street S and Hoff’s Outlot 1 to Block 2 and Outlot 1 to Block 3, Melgaard Park Addition to Aberdeen, adjacent to Lots 7-9, Block 2, Lots 7-8, Block 1 and Lots 1 and 12-15, Block 3 {00056254.DOC / 1} 1 Aberdeen City Planning Commission September 17, 2019 and Lots 1 & 12, Block 4, Melgaard Park Addition to Aberdeen, and all Public Alley ROW adjacent to Lots 1-14, Block 1, Lots 1-9, Block 2, Lots 1-15, Block 3 and Lots 1-12, Block 4, Melgaard Park Addition to Aberdeen,” (a.k.a. 423 17th Ave SE – School for the Visually Impaired) was submitted by Northern State University. Eric Miller stated that the petitioner is submitting this petition to vacate multiple undeveloped public street and alley right-of-way in order to allow for the replatting of this property in preparation for the construction of their new football stadium. The petitioners are having a plat prepared to consolidate the underlying lots with these sections of public right-of-way and will be submitting that along with a petition to rezone this parcel to the Municipal, State, & County Use District. Following discussion Cogley moved and Schumacher seconded to approve with the stipulations that the vacated right-of-way is incorporated to the adjacent lots in future replatting of the property and that access easements are maintained for any current or future utilities. Upon roll call, all members voting aye, the motion carried. Chairman Marske continued with other business as follows: 1) Brett Bill stated that future Planning Commission meetings will start @ 6:00 p.m. starting with the November, 2019 meeting. There being no further business before the Commission, Woodward moved and Schumacher seconded to adjourn the meeting, all members voting aye, the motion carried. Adjournment FORMAT GUIDELINES: 1) Open forum provides an opportunity for the public to address the Aberdeen City Planning Commission with questions, concerns or comments on items, which are not on the agenda. Citizens are asked to sign up to speak prior to the open forum portion of the meeting. Open forum will be limited to 10 minutes (if no one is in attendance for the open forum, the regular meeting may begin) unless a majority of the Aberdeen City Planning Commission agrees to extend the time period. {00055842.DOC / 1} The open forum may not be used to make personal attacks, to air personality grievances, to make political endorsements, or for political campaign purposes. Open forum will not be used as a time for problem solving or reacting to the comments made, but, rather for hearing the citizen for informational purposes. The Aberdeen City Planning Commission may respond with request for city management to follow up and report back on any issue raised during the public address time. A presentation may not exceed two minutes in duration. 2) ADA Compliance: The City of Aberdeen fully subscribes to the provisions of the American ’s With Disabilities Act.
